What is energy defined as in scientific terms?
The ability to do work
The ability to create matter
The ability to generate heat
The ability to produce light
Answer explanation
In scientific terms, energy is defined as the ability to do work. This encompasses various forms of energy, including kinetic, potential, and thermal energy, all of which can perform work in different contexts.

What is a major drawback of using fossil fuels?
They are renewable
They produce no pollution
They release carbon dioxide
They are easy to replenish
Answer explanation
A major drawback of using fossil fuels is that they release carbon dioxide, a greenhouse gas that contributes to climate change. This is a significant environmental concern, unlike the incorrect options which suggest benefits.

How does hydroelectric power generate electricity?
By burning organic materials
By using the energy of moving water
By converting sunlight into energy
By using wind turbines
Answer explanation
Hydroelectric power generates electricity by using the energy of moving water. As water flows through turbines, it spins them, converting kinetic energy into electrical energy, making this the correct choice.

What type of energy do wind turbines convert?
Thermal energy
Electrical energy
Kinetic energy
Chemical energy
Answer explanation
Wind turbines convert kinetic energy from the wind into mechanical energy, which is then transformed into electrical energy. Therefore, the correct answer is kinetic energy.

What is the primary method by which geothermal energy is harnessed?
By using solar panels
By burning fossil fuels
By drilling into the Earth's surface to access heat
By splitting atoms in nuclear fission
Answer explanation
Geothermal energy is primarily harnessed by drilling into the Earth's surface to access the heat stored beneath. This method allows for the extraction of thermal energy, unlike the other options listed.

Which of the following is a characteristic of solar energy?
It produces harmful emissions
It is a non-renewable energy source
It converts sunlight into electricity using photovoltaic cells
It relies on the burning of coal
Answer explanation
Solar energy is harnessed by converting sunlight into electricity using photovoltaic cells, making it a clean and renewable energy source. The other options incorrectly describe solar energy.
